Description of key information

The 96 h LC50 of the test substance to the freshwater fish, Danio rerio (zebra fish) was greater than the threshold concentration of 25.8 µg/L (geometric mean measured concentration).

Additional information

A study was conducted to determine the acute toxicity of the test substance to the freshwater fish, Danio rerio (zebra fish) under semi-static conditions according to the OECD Guideline 203 in compliance with GLP. In this study, the fish was exposed to the test substance at the nominal threshold concentration (TC) of 0.11 mg/L. The TC was based on the results of an algae study with this substance. Chemical analysis of the test concentrations was carried out in old and new solutions. Recoveries did not remain above 80% of the nominal concentrations. A geometric mean measured concentration was therefore calculated and used for endpoint determination. All critical validity criteria were met. No lethal or sub lethal or behavioral effects of any kind were observed in the test concentration. No mortality occurred in control also. Under the test conditions, the 96 h LC50 of the test substance was greater than the threshold concentration of 25.8 µg/L (geometric mean measured concentration).
